A cube and cuboid have the same base area. The volume of the cube is 64cm3 while that of the cuboid is 80cm3. Find the height of the cuboid

A.

1cm

B.

3cm

C.

5cm

D.

6cm

Correct answer is C

Volume of a cube with side a cm = a3

a3 = 64 a = 4cm

Base area of a cube = a2

= 42

= 16 cm2

Base area of the cuboid = 16 cm2

Volume of cuboid = Base area x height

80 = 16 x h

h = 8016

= 5 cm
